Using SharePoint Online , we encounter the following error when creating a new url. using a subsite template:

Site collection

e995e28b-9ba8-4668-9933-cf5c146d7a9f

Not activated

Is there a solution, which avoids using the online SharePoint Management Shell?

In the site collection feature the "Office Web App" is not listed.

Any suggestions?

This issue was posted to the Service Health Dashboard (SHD) as incident SP72910 starting at Jul 21 2016 12:00AM (UTC). The user experience of this incident is: Site owners may be unable to create subsites using custom templates. Using default templates works as expected.
